McCall council directs staff to finalize draft transportation impact guidelines to standardize traffic reviews
Summary
The McCall City Council on Sept. 25 directed staff to finalize a first‑ever draft of Transportation Impact Analysis (TIA) guidelines that set thresholds and a scoping process for traffic memos and studies, require scoping meetings, and add seasonal and multimodal considerations to reflect McCall’s resort traffic patterns.
The McCall City Council on Sept. 25 directed city staff to finalize a draft Transportation Impact Analysis guidance document that would set when developers must prepare traffic memos or full traffic impact studies and standardize study methods for the city.
City staff said the guidelines would make traffic review more consistent and transparent by establishing thresholds (for example, a memo for projects under roughly 200 weekday trips or 20 dwelling units and a full study for larger developments), requiring a scoping meeting with staff and consultants, and adding multimodal and seasonal considerations…
